Abstract

Disclosed is a method and apparatus for the lowcost assembly of precision optical devices utilizing single or multiple bounces. The apparatus makes use of a precision machined alignment platform to support optical mirrors in precise alignment. A low cost holding structure is clamped over the alignment platform to position one of a plurality of connected sections adjacent to the back of each mirror. An adhesive is injected through holes provided in the holding structure adjacent to the back of each mirror. The adhesive bridges each mirror to the holding structure in a position corresponding exactly to the position of the mirrors on the alignment platform, thereby eliminating any need to adjust the mirrors for correct alignment.
